Energy Econ 20: On Slashing the Max Power Generation Charge

When there is thin or very small power reserves on peak demand hours of hot months April-May, there are two options. (1) Have rotating brown outs, kill electricity demand for a few hours in some areas; or (2) get expensive power from peak-load plants like diesel barges and avoid brown-outs.

The P32/kwh max rate (usually for 1 or 2 hours, and used to be P62/kwh) allowed in WESM (vs average price of about P5/kwh) looks exorbitant, true. But if it will help avoid a brown out of 1 or 2 hours, it may look less merciless as other people would describe it. So some businessmen are willing to invest in diesel barges that may run only 1 to 3 hours a day (vs. base load plants like coal and nat gas that run 24 hours a day), in exchange for a higher generation charge.

Now there are moves by the ERC and DOE to slash the max rate to only P6.25/kwh.

A power investor will only put his money in base load plants that run 24/7 and selling at P4-7/kwh, not in peak load plants that may run only 1-3 hours a day on hot months, and zero on rainy and cold months, and be allowed by the ERC to charge only P6+/kwh. When there are no or very few peak load plants to address short-term high electricity demand, frequent brown outs on hot months will happen.

When there is frequent brown out, people will resort to (a) buying generator sets, which are costly and running on costly diesel, or (b) have more candles and experience more fires. People forgetting to attend to their candles which accidental fell down, burned a piece of paper, ultimtely burning the entire house and the neighboring houses.

Electricity supply should be big relative to demand. Electricity prices should be low due to competition among many power generating companies. This thing is not happening yet. DOE itself is part of the problem why power supply is limited.

Another adverse result of forced conservation as narrated by Bembette. A government office saves from monthly electricity bill but spends more on appliances maintenance, or replacing them with a new unit.

Grace's observation is correct, it should be done during period of emergencies and unforeseen events. Either the power plants conk out, or there is power but the transmission lines or distribution lines are cut off due to toppled electrical posts. It is different in predictable or foreseen events, like high electricity demand in the hot months of March-April-May, the last two especially.

And this partless addresses the disappointment of Rose. Consumers can bring down their electricity bill by shifting some of their activities to non-peak hours, say doing electric laundry, ironing, electronic work, at non-peak hours.

Andrew's proposal is incorporated in the long term direction of the wholesale electricity spot market (WESM), pricing by the hour. Thus, cheaper monthly electricity bill for those who are using more electricity during non-peak hours. Currently, the distribution utilities like the various electric cooperatives nationwide lump the pricing in one average price for the month. Thus, users of electricity during non-peak hours subsidize those who use more electricity during peak hours.

During the open forum. I reiterated that many of the electricity angsts of the public were not created by the Electric Power Industry Reform Act of 2001 (EPIRA). For instance, (1) Meralco monopoly is not created by EPIRA but by the Constitution (utilities reserved solely for Filipinos) and Congressional franchising. (2) Multiple taxation of power (royalties on natural gas, local taxes, excise tax, VAT, other taxes that all contribute to expensive electricity, were not created by EPIRA but by various tax laws, national and local. (3) Bureaucracies that make it difficult for new players and generating companies (gencos) to come in resulting in limited competition were not created by EPIRA but by various regulations, enacted by Congress or the various agencies (DOE, DENR, BIR, LGUs, etc.).

In short, calls to repeal EPIRA and go back to government centralization and monopolization of power generation and transmission are misplaced and wrong.

Our monthly electricity bill is composed of about nine items: generation charge, transmission charge, distribution charge, supply charge, metering charge, system loss charge, universal charge, lifeline subsidy, and taxes. Generation charge comprises about 50 percent of the total bill.

I discussed the immediate cause of the power rate hike last December -- a combination of planned/scheduled shutdowns and unplanned/unscheduled shutdowns of several power plants running on natural gas and coal, two of the cheap sources of electricity. Some power plants that run on nat gas had to run on diesel, or oil-fired power plants were tapped, to prevent brownouts.

The way forward for the power industry

THE RECENT sharp spike in power rates led to the understandable shock and anger of consumers; most are unfamiliar with the structure and workings of a now market-based power industry. Headline news and public discourse have generated more heat than light. It can be satisfying to embrace conspiracy as a short-cut to thinking about a complex subject which the ideologically opposed to privatization are quick to fan.

  
What is emerging though from various congress hearings and submissions to the Supreme Court, is that this temporary two month spike was a product of a most unlikely and unfortunate perfect storm of planned and unplanned plant outages on top of already thin reserves. And what failures there were arose not from collusion, but from a bid and offer system that requires further refining, and perhaps, from insufficient diligence.

By way of disclosure, I was Undersecretary of Finance during the last two years of Aquino 1 and the first four years of Ramos administrations, an independent director in one major publicly listed power company and in an unlisted diversified holding company active in the energy business. While in government, I was involved in trying to addresss crippling blackouts in the early 1990’s that led the government to contract Independent Power Producers (IPPs) as part of the solution. Quick solutions had to be found -- the most expensive power was no power. Due to the outages, GDP flatlined for two years, 1990/92, lost output of P800 billion in today’s prices, equivalent to twice the cost of government’s infrastructure budget last year, or 20 years of its conditional cash transfer program. This is not even counting investments that were driven away, and the country’s lost momentum.

I resurrect this dark episode in Philippine economic history as a background to what may ensue if counterproductive actions are taken that lead to underinvestment yet again in power generation. Under the Electric Power Industry Reform Act (EPIRA; 2001) it is private sector players who are expected to deliver electricity under a competitive playing field, with government providing the enabling environment. This national policy was not arrived at willy-nilly but after seven years of debate both within the executive department and in Congress, with the active participation of all affected publics.

Modelled after successful privatizing countries, EPIRA was a recognition of the fiscal and institutional limitations of government in building and running power assets efficiently. As we know, such led to costly under-provision during the blackout years, and expensive stranded costs when the long-term growth forecasts failed to materialize post 1997 Asian Crisis.

Today many questions have been raised on whether EPIRA was a success. I submit that, while there has been a delay, a fair call is “so far, so good.” EPIRA has provided the framework for the restructuring of the Electric Power Industry, including privatization of National Power Corp.’s assets, defining the responsibilities of various government agencies and the private sector, and transitioning to a functioning competitive structure. The end goal was to make sure we had an ample and reliable supply of electricity, at reasonable and competitive rates.

With the debate on whether the power generation rate increase -- mistakenly referred to as "Meralco rate hike" -- is justified or not, the role of WESM has been put under question.

The Wholesale Electricity Spot Market was created under Sec. 30 of Republic Act 9136 or the Electric Power Industry Reform Act of 2001 (EPIRA). Power generators, distribution utilities (DUs) and electric cooperatives, bulk consumers, similar entities authorized by the Energy Regulatory Commission (ERC) can participate there.

Below are some allegations or criticisms about WESM:

1.  DUs or electric cooperatives like Meralco collude with certain power generators and bid up the price at WESM.

2.  DUs and bulk consumers can easily buy forward contracts or buy electricity for specified short periods in the future to cover any foreseen exposure they may have. This is on top of their long-term bilateral contracts with power generators.

3.  DUs who buy at WESM would know who supplied them power at any time, any day.

4.  It is “a misnomer, a huge farce: More than 90 percent of its transactions aren’t spot trading transactions at all. They are bilateral contracts, with the price and quantity not having anything to do with market conditions at any given time.”

5.  The rule that WESM “must offer all available electricity capacity to the spot market” is mocked and disobeyed by many power companies by offering the maximum bid of P62 per kilowatt-hour (kWh).

6. WESM and its high rates in the November-December period could have been bypassed by running the state-owned Malaya power plants.

How true or valid are these allegations? Let us tackle each of them -- with hard data.

1.  The allegation of collusion between some DUs like Meralco and power generators is belied by the average generation cost in 2013 -- P5.52 per kWh – which was lower than the P5.76 in 2012. The spike in the December billing – which was based on the November generation cost -- was mainly due to the absence of cheaper natural gas from Malampaya, and the purchase of more expensive power from diesel plants, so that brownouts would be avoided.

To prove “collusion,” one must show who colluded. Barring this, collusion is simply an allegation. Item number three below will illustrate why identifying who colluded is impossible. 


2.  DUs and bulk consumers can buy or contract electricity at WESM – say about 10 percent of their projected demand -- just one or two hours ahead, not weeks or months ahead. There is an allowance if some of its contracted generator plants will conk out or suffer output reduction due to mechanical problems, or the demand would suddenly go up.  It is a spot market and as such is characterized by price volatility. But at least power supply is delivered, and disruption or a brownout, is avoided. When supply exceeds demand by a wide margin, the price goes down. When this margin narrows, the price goes up.

Here is a short history of WESM prices from July 2006 to November 2013. The three outliers, January 2009 – when prices were very low -- and February-March 2010 and November-December 2013 – when prices were very high -- are explained in bold sentences. Note the lower cost of WESM load-weighted average price (LWAP) compared to average Napocor rates.


3.  Knowing who sold power and by how much at WESM is fungible. When you buy, you no longer know from which plant and how much power is coming, so there is no way Meralco or ERC can know. Suppose there are 10 generators (excluding those covered by bilateral contracts) supplying WESM in a given hour, and there are 60 buyers (excluding those covered by bilateral contracts) during the same hour, it is impossible to attribute to one generator any output bought by a buyer.

Take this case. On December 6 -- or two days before Typhoon ‘Yolanda’ struck Eastern and Central Visayas -- coal and hydro plants could produce less than 5,000 MW in Luzon, while demand stood at 5,400 MW. More than 3,200 MW of power were either on planned/scheduled shutdown or on forced outage. The oil/diesel plants provided the power to address demand that coal and hydro could not supply. But the supply came at a higher price, in exchange for no brownout that day in Luzon.


Knowing which among the various oil-based power plants supplied how much energy to different DUs and bulk consumers at different prices at different hours of the day cannot be determined. DUs decide whether to buy at that particular price that hour, or beg off on those hours and suffer brownouts in certain cities and municipalities of their franchise area.
